Japan is certainly no stranger to viral dance videos and one doesn¡¯t have to think too far back to recall the popularity of the koi (falling in love) dance routine that took the internet by storm last year.
Popularized by TV drama ¡°Nigeru wa Hajidaga Yaku ni Tatsu¡± (roughly translated as ¡°Running Away is Shameful but Useful¡°), the quirky routine even prompted employees at U.S. government agencies in Japan to air their own winter holiday version featuring then-U.S. Ambassador Caroline Kennedy.
While such viral dance routines are nothing new, internet users have recently shown a fondness for videos that tap into cross-generational influences.
